Output ded758e800c0419d239eec7791b004429eafed5a0084c33de75803e9c2fe6906:0

value
19882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7784e85cc0343ffeb60817bf3987a57f74cb45f8 OP_EQUAL
address
3CayYxX8chRF1kwWtin3MCVM4Ff7vNELJw
transaction
ded758e800c0419d239eec7791b004429eafed5a0084c33de75803e9c2fe6906
spent
true